如何利用MySQL创建高效全文索引(创建全文索引mysql)

MySQL是最火热的关系型数据库管理系统之一,包含数据库事务处理,访问控制,记录锁定,全文索引,统计信息等功能。MySQL的全文索引可用于检索字符和文本型数据,从而改善服务器的性能。全文索引的创建不仅可以改善服务器的性能,而且可以有效提高MySQL用户的数据库可用性,以使用户更快地访问其存储的数据。本文将提供一些技术指导,介绍如何使用MySQL创建高效全文索引。

首先,需要在MySQL客户端中创建/重建索引,以便索引数据表中的文本列。MySQL要求使用索引的数据表中的列有独一无二的值,以确保查询结果的准确性。为此,可以使用“DROP INDEX”语句,对已有的索引重新构建和选择列。其次,应创建合适的索引类型。MySQL提供多种索引类型,其中有效果最好的是全文索引,全文索引可以有效地提高MySQL服务器的性能。最后,使用MySQL客户端进行索引创建,并执行许多保存查询时间的SQL语句。MySQL提供了一些索引类型,以改进查询性能,其中最常用的是全文索引。

例如,假设我们有一个名为“users”的表,其中包含一个列,名为“bio”,储存用户的个人简介,现在我们想创建一个全文索引作为搜索索引,可以使用以下语句实现:

“`SQL

CREATE FULLTEXT INDEX ON users(bio);


以上就是如何利用MySQL创建高效全文索引的方法,一旦索引建立之后,将可以通过搜索关键词来快速查询数据库中相关内容,从而提高MySQL服务器的性能。此外,要注意正确使用MySQL客户端,以确保索引能够按期更新,以确保查询请求的及时处理。

数据运维技术 » 如何利用MySQL创建高效全文索引(创建全文索引mysql)